"100 miles and 33,000 feet of vertical gain over high alpine terrain on foot."
Every year, in the San Juan Mountains of Colorado, 140 elite ultra runners test themselves against one of the worlds hardest running challenges. The Hardrock 100 ultra marathon consists of over 33,000 ft of elevation gain through some of the most rugged and unforgiving alpine terrain in the United States. For Darcy Piceu Africa, this race is a mental and physical battle that challenges her to push through boundaries in ways she never thought possible. This film documents the the challange of the 2013 Hardrock through Darcy's experience, as she takes on the San Juans and attempts to defend her title and become back-to-back Hardrock champion.
I was on location to document Darcy's attempt to win back to back titles at the 2013 race in Silverton - this was my 4th straight year shooting hardrock, but the first time covering this incredible race in motion instead of stills.
